Key Growth Drivers
Growth will be sustained by the increasing necessity for clear communication between autonomous vehicles and human pedestrians. As cars handle more of the driving workload, the need for the vehicle to communicate its status—such as "pedestrian detection" or "braking"—will lead to the adoption of standardized lighting arrays, effectively pushing the market forward.

Technological Innovations and Emerging Trends
The forecast points to the emergence of flexible, non-planar LED arrays that can conform to the curves of the vehicle’s grille. This innovation will allow designers to break away from rigid, linear layouts, creating more organic and aesthetically pleasing light designs that flow with the body panels.
